Two Lots of J&J’s Risperidone Recalled Over Odor Concerns
June 24, 2011
Johnson & Johnson (J&J) is recalling one lot of Risperdal tablets, and one lot of risperidone 2 mg tablets marketed by Patriot Pharmaceuticals, due to uncharacteristic odor thought to be caused by trace amounts of TBA (2,4, 6- tribromoanisole).
